==== Memories of the Tmimim ==== * '''I am Abraham's Servant''' - In the introduction, memories from Yeshivas Tomchei Tmimim Lubavitch, Yeshivas Achei Tmimim Tel Aviv, Yeshivas Tomchei Tmimim Lod, Rabbi Eliezer Krasik * '''Reshimos Devorim''' - Memories from Yeshivas Tomchei Tmimim Lubavitch, Yeshivas Tomchei Tmimim Kharkov, Yeshivas Tomchei Tmimim Kremenchug, Yeshivas Tomchei Tmimim Rostov, Yeshivas Tomchei Tmimim Montreal, Rabbi Yehuda Chitrik * '''My Memories''' - Memories and history of Rabbi Shmarya Sassonkin. Memories from Yeshivas Tomchei Tmimim Lubavitch, Yeshivas Tomchei Tmimim Batumi Georgia, edited by Rabbi Naftali Tzvi Gottlieb, 1988 (New edition - 2013) * '''The First Tomim''', History of Rabbi Shneur Zalman Gurary, documentation about Rabbi Gurary as one of the first Tmimim in the yeshiva * '''Zichron L'Bnei Yisroel''', Memories of Rabbi Yisroel Jacobson from Yeshivas Tomchei Tmimim Lubavitch, and Tomchei Tmimim yeshivas throughout Russia
